Georgia Woman Charged with Homicide for Crash That Killed Six People

A Georgia woman has been arrested and charged with six counts of homicide after police say she made a reckless lane change that led the van she was driving to crash, killing six passengers, The Associated Press reported.

The Gwinnett County Police Department issued a press release Thursday stating that they believe the driver of the van, Monica Manire, made an improper lane change on the interstate that caused the van carrying 16 passengers to flip on its side. 

Police said that witnesses to the accident told them another vehicle unexpectedly changed lanes ahead of the van. Manire’s vehicle flipped on its side, skidded across the interstate and burst into flames, according to the AP.
